WORKSHOP: Introduction to Large Format Photography
Saturday, April 12th, 2025, 12 to 5pm
Large format photography is an intimidating subject. It has a reputation for being complex and expensive. Even if you have a mentor to hold your hand while you learn “the dance,” there is usually a significant up-front cost to purchase a camera, lens, and supporting infrastructure. This workshop is an opportunity to try large format photography in a wide variety of situations without having to purchase any new gear. You will have the opportunity to shoot architecture, landscape, macro, still-life, and portrait work both in a studio space using professional lighting set-ups and outdoors working with natural light. Together, we’ll go over the process of loading, exposing, developing, and printing with large format film. We’ll also talk about some resources for learning more about large format photography, tips for buying gear, and ways to shoot economically. You will take home at least four 4×5 negatives, a contact sheet, an 8×10 paper negative, and the accompanying contact print. VCP will provide film, paper, and darkroom chemistry.
